iT邦幫忙

2019 iT 邦幫忙鐵人賽

DAY 7
0

OpenCart 內建的後端商品管理功能,是先提供商品篩選功能,篩選出商品清單之後,須再點入商品編輯,才能進行商品資料的編輯。所以當您要更改某項商品的(上架/下架)狀態時,必須先進入商品編輯頁面,再切換到明細資料的分頁,然後再捲動畫面到接近最下方,才能看到狀態欄位,下拉切換狀態並再捲動畫面到最上方按儲存之後,才能完成商品狀態(上架/下架)的更新。整個操作程序必須來回換頁及捲動、點擊多次,如果您需要同時上下架很多筆商品時,你一定就會覺得很麻煩,就會希望能有更快速的方法,能簡化上下架商品的操作。

這種只會從商品名稱的開頭比對的模式,真的不太合乎台灣人的使用習慣,台灣地區的使用者應該比較習慣採用模糊比對,就是任意位置有比對到都算的那種。

今天要介紹的這套 EnableDisable Products 模組,提供了快速上下架的功能,做法是在畫面最上方提供了上架及下架2個按鈕,可以搭配商品列前端的checkbox,勾選一批商品之後再整批上下架,真的比原本的操作省下非常多的步驟,雖然是免費的小模組,還是相當的實用。

懂 PHP 的人,可以研究一下這套模組,了解其運作的程式邏輯之後,可以套用在很多類似的功能上,各種批次的管理作業,都可以做到,這也是採用 OpenCart 系統最大的優點,不只可以優化操作,還能降低人工操作產生疏失的機率,如果程式更熟悉了之後,不論是特殊功能的開發、不同系統(例如ERP)的串接,都不是太難的事,如果是採用開店平台,就不是你想要改什麼就能改什麼了。

模組主頁

https://www.opencart.com/index.php?route=marketplace/extension/info&extension_id=22888

模組名稱

EnableDisable Products - add buttons for batch processing

模組廠商說明

EnableDisable Products module simplifies the process of working with the goods, adding Enable / Disable buttons for batch processing.
Also possible to Activate / Deactivate ALL products by pressing a single button, plus a couple of pleasant things.

參考資源

OpenCart 網站代管、客製、維護 https://www.osec.tw/
OpenCart 台灣技術支援粉絲頁 https://www.facebook.com/ntcart/
OpenCart 台灣優化版專頁 https://www.osec.tw/opencart.html
OpenCart 台灣中文用戶討論區 https://www.ntcart.com/


上一篇
後端商品管理自動完成(Autocomplete)改成支援模糊搜尋 - OpenCart 免費模組 Day06
下一篇
後端商品管理的快速編輯 - OpenCart 免費模組 Day08
系列文
OpenCart 購物網站系統的30個實用擴充模組30

尚未有邦友留言

立即登入留言